
如何用主板自带RAID
主板自带RAID是指利用主板上集成的RAID控制器来创建和管理RAID阵列。提高数据读取速度、增强数据冗余和安全性、简化存储管理等是主板自带RAID的主要优势。具体来说,提高数据读取速度是其中的一个重要方面。通过RAID 0(条带化)可以将数据分布到多个硬盘上,多个硬盘同时读取数据,从而显著提高数据读取速度。这对于需要高性能存储的应用,如大型数据库和视频编辑等场景,尤为适用。
一、RAID的基础知识
RAID的定义和类型
RAID(Redundant Array of Independent Disks)是一种将多个物理硬盘组合成一个逻辑单元的存储技术。其主要类型包括:
- RAID 0(条带化):将数据分布到多个硬盘上,提高读写速度,但没有冗余。
- RAID 1(镜像):将数据完整地复制到另一块硬盘上,提供冗余和备份,但存储利用率低。
- RAID 5(分布式奇偶校验):数据和奇偶校验信息分布在多个硬盘上,提供冗余和较高的存储利用率。
- RAID 10(RAID 1+0):结合RAID 0和RAID 1的优点,既提高速度又提供冗余。
主板自带RAID的优势
主板自带RAID控制器通常集成在主板的芯片组中,提供了一种经济实惠且易于实现的RAID解决方案。主要优势包括:
- 成本低:无需额外购买独立的RAID控制器。
- 易于设置:通过BIOS或UEFI界面进行配置,操作相对简单。
- 性能提升:在某些情况下,主板自带RAID控制器能提供足够的性能提升。
二、配置主板自带RAID的准备工作
硬件准备
在配置主板自带RAID之前,需要确保以下硬件准备就绪:
- 兼容主板:确保主板支持RAID功能,检查主板手册或制造商网站以确认。
- 多个硬盘:根据所需的RAID类型,准备相应数量的硬盘。建议使用相同型号和容量的硬盘以确保最佳性能。
- 数据备份:配置RAID可能会删除现有数据,因此务必先备份所有重要数据。
软件和工具准备
在开始配置之前,还需要准备一些必要的软件和工具:
- 主板驱动程序:确保已经安装了最新的主板驱动程序,特别是RAID控制器的驱动程序。
- 操作系统安装介质:如果计划在RAID阵列上安装操作系统,需要准备好操作系统的安装光盘或U盘。
- RAID管理工具:一些主板制造商提供专用的RAID管理软件,便于在操作系统中管理RAID阵列。
三、通过BIOS/UEFI配置RAID
进入BIOS/UEFI界面
要配置主板自带RAID,首先需要进入BIOS或UEFI界面。一般来说,启动计算机后立即按下DEL、F2或其他特定按键即可进入BIOS/UEFI设置界面。
启用RAID功能
在BIOS/UEFI界面中,需要找到并启用RAID功能。具体步骤可能因主板品牌和型号不同而有所差异,但大致流程如下:
- 导航到存储设置:在BIOS/UEFI界面中,找到与存储或SATA设置相关的选项。
- 启用RAID模式:将存储模式从AHCI更改为RAID模式,保存并退出BIOS/UEFI。
配置RAID阵列
启用RAID模式后,计算机将重新启动并进入RAID配置界面。具体步骤如下:
- 进入RAID配置界面:在启动过程中,按下提示的特定按键(如Ctrl+I或F12)进入RAID配置界面。
- 创建RAID阵列:选择创建RAID阵列选项,按照提示选择硬盘并配置RAID类型(如RAID 0、RAID 1等)。
- 设置阵列参数:根据需要设置阵列名称、条带大小(对于RAID 0)等参数,完成配置并保存。
四、在操作系统中安装和管理RAID
安装操作系统
在RAID阵列上安装操作系统时,可能需要加载RAID驱动程序。以下是具体步骤:
- 启动操作系统安装程序:从光盘或U盘启动操作系统安装程序。
- 加载RAID驱动程序:在安装过程中,当提示选择硬盘时,选择加载驱动程序选项,插入包含RAID驱动程序的介质并加载驱动。
- 选择RAID阵列进行安装:加载驱动程序后,安装程序将识别RAID阵列,选择阵列作为安装目标并完成操作系统安装。
使用RAID管理工具
安装操作系统后,可以使用主板制造商提供的RAID管理工具来监控和管理RAID阵列。常见功能包括:
- 监控硬盘状态:实时监控硬盘健康状态,及时发现和处理故障硬盘。
- 重建RAID阵列:在RAID 1或RAID 5等冗余阵列中,出现硬盘故障时,可以使用工具进行阵列重建。
- 调整阵列参数:根据需要调整阵列参数,如条带大小、缓存策略等,以优化性能。
五、RAID维护和故障处理
定期备份和监控
虽然RAID提供了一定程度的冗余,但仍需定期备份重要数据,以防止意外数据丢失。此外,定期监控RAID阵列的状态,及时发现并处理潜在问题。
硬盘故障处理
在RAID阵列中,硬盘故障是常见问题。处理步骤如下:
- 识别故障硬盘:使用RAID管理工具或BIOS/UEFI界面识别故障硬盘。
- 更换故障硬盘:根据硬盘型号和容量,准备并更换故障硬盘。
- 重建RAID阵列:在RAID管理工具中选择重建阵列选项,按照提示进行重建。
RAID阵列迁移和扩展
在需要升级硬盘或迁移数据时,可以使用RAID管理工具进行阵列迁移和扩展。具体步骤包括:
- 准备新硬盘:根据需求准备新的硬盘,确保其兼容性。
- 添加新硬盘:在RAID管理工具中添加新硬盘,并选择迁移或扩展选项。
- 完成迁移或扩展:按照提示完成迁移或扩展过程,并验证数据完整性。
六、RAID性能优化
选择合适的RAID类型
不同的RAID类型适用于不同的应用场景,选择合适的RAID类型是性能优化的关键:
- RAID 0:适用于需要高读写速度的应用,如视频编辑和大型数据库。
- RAID 1:适用于需要高数据安全性的应用,如财务数据和重要文档存储。
- RAID 5:适用于需要平衡性能和冗余的应用,如文件服务器和虚拟化环境。
调整条带大小和缓存策略
在配置RAID阵列时,可以根据具体应用需求调整条带大小和缓存策略,以优化性能:
- 条带大小:适用于RAID 0,较大的条带大小适用于大文件传输,较小的条带大小适用于小文件读写。
- 缓存策略:启用写缓存可以提高写入性能,但可能增加数据丢失风险。根据具体应用需求选择合适的缓存策略。
使用高性能硬盘和接口
选择高性能硬盘和接口,如SSD和NVMe接口,可以显著提升RAID阵列的整体性能。此外,确保RAID控制器支持并充分利用这些高性能硬盘和接口。
七、RAID的应用场景和案例分析
企业存储和备份
在企业环境中,RAID广泛应用于存储和备份解决方案。以下是一个典型案例:
某公司使用RAID 5配置文件服务器,以提供高效的存储和数据冗余。通过RAID 5,多个硬盘上的数据和奇偶校验信息分布均匀,即使一块硬盘故障,数据仍然可以恢复。此外,定期备份和监控进一步保障了数据的安全性。
视频编辑和多媒体处理
对于需要高读写速度的视频编辑和多媒体处理应用,RAID 0是常见选择。以下是一个实际应用案例:
某视频制作公司使用RAID 0配置存储系统,以提高视频文件的读写速度。通过将数据分布到多个硬盘上,RAID 0提供了极高的读写性能,使得大型视频文件的处理更加高效。然而,由于RAID 0没有冗余,该公司同时采取了定期备份策略,以防止数据丢失。
个人家庭存储
在个人和家庭环境中,RAID 1是常见选择,适用于存储重要数据和个人文件。以下是一个具体案例:
某家庭用户使用RAID 1配置存储系统,将重要的个人文件和家庭照片存储在两块硬盘上。通过RAID 1,数据在两块硬盘上实时镜像,即使一块硬盘故障,数据仍然安全无虞。此外,用户还定期将数据备份到外部存储设备,以增加数据安全性。
八、RAID与云存储的对比
本地RAID的优势
本地RAID存储具有以下优势:
- 高性能:本地RAID阵列通常提供更高的读写速度,适用于需要高性能存储的应用。
- 数据控制:用户完全控制数据的存储和访问,无需依赖第三方服务。
- 一次性成本:本地RAID存储仅需一次性购买硬件,无需持续支付订阅费用。
云存储的优势
相较于本地RAID,云存储具有以下优势:
- 高可用性:云存储服务通常提供高可用性和冗余,确保数据持续可用。
- 易于扩展:云存储可以根据需求灵活扩展,无需购买额外硬件。
- 远程访问:用户可以从任何有网络连接的设备访问云存储中的数据,提供了极大的便利性。
综合对比与选择
在选择本地RAID和云存储时,需要综合考虑以下因素:
- 性能需求:对于需要高性能存储的应用,本地RAID更为适合。
- 数据安全性:云存储服务通常提供更高的数据安全性和冗余。
- 成本预算:本地RAID具有一次性成本,而云存储需要持续支付订阅费用。
- 访问便利性:云存储提供了远程访问的便利性,而本地RAID需要物理访问设备。
通过综合对比和分析,用户可以根据具体需求选择适合的存储解决方案。
九、总结
主板自带RAID提供了一种经济实惠且易于实现的存储解决方案,通过合理配置和管理,可以显著提升存储性能和数据安全性。提高数据读取速度、增强数据冗余和安全性、简化存储管理是其主要优势。在实际应用中,选择合适的RAID类型、定期备份和监控、以及根据具体需求进行性能优化,都是确保RAID系统稳定高效运行的重要措施。通过本文的详细介绍和案例分析,相信读者可以更好地理解和应用主板自带RAID技术,为自己的存储需求提供有效解决方案。
相关问答FAQs:
1. 什么是主板自带的RAID功能?
主板自带的RAID功能是一种硬件级别的数据存储技术,它允许您将多个硬盘驱动器组合成一个逻辑驱动器,以提供更高的数据传输速度、数据冗余和容错能力。
2. 如何启用主板上的RAID功能?
要启用主板上的RAID功能,您需要进入BIOS设置界面。在BIOS中,找到存储设置或SATA设置选项,并将其更改为RAID模式。然后,保存设置并重新启动计算机。在操作系统启动后,您将能够配置和管理RAID阵列。
3. 如何创建一个RAID阵列?
要创建一个RAID阵列,您需要在BIOS设置中找到RAID配置选项。选择创建一个新的RAID阵列,并选择要使用的硬盘驱动器。根据您的需求选择RAID级别(如RAID 0、RAID 1或RAID 5)和其他设置。完成后,保存设置并重新启动计算机。您的RAID阵列现在已经创建成功,并可以在操作系统中使用。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/3192862